Credit Requirement
Student admitted after 2009
- General Education : Minimum 36 credits
- Major Courses : Minimum 60 credits (Refer to core major courses and Physical Education department standards) * Minimum 52 credits for other major completion)
- Teaching : Minimum 22 credits (Teaching theory : Min. 14 credits, Teaching Aptitude : Min.4 credits, Student Teaching : Min. 4 credits)
Bylaws(2010. 2. ~)
- Must complete at least 5 courses including Physical Education 1, 2, extracurricular activities, and life sports.
- ※ must take required courses (track-and-field1(track), apparatus gymnastics1(floor), swimming1, PE course, PE method)
- Must take one course from aquatic sport course (choose 1 from yacht, windsurfing, scuba diving) and ski course (ski, snowboarding).
- ※ ☆ must take curriculum education course (Theories of Physical Education (physical activity fundamentals), Sports Education (PE course), PE teaching material research and PE method guidance).
- Students enrolled after 1998 must take at least 21 credits (3credits X 7 semesters) of practicum courses.
- Depending on credited practicum courses, student may take practical examination for graduation.
- Female(dance) graduation practical courses includes gymnastics(choose1), track-and-field(choose1), ball sports(choose 1) added (from April 2013 faculty meeting).
- PE liberal arts courses are not included in graduation requirement credits (130credits).
- Repeated taking of dance education (2), modern dance (3), Korean dance (4) is allowed.
- Students graded A- and better in graduation practicum course are exempt from practical examination of that course.
- Female students must complete ‘Introduction to modern dance’, ‘Introduction to Korean dance’ class.
